520420 2022-01-29T22:22:40 Z keta_tsimakuridze 휴가 (IOI14_holiday) C++14
100 / 100
1479 ms 19368 KB
#include"holiday.h"
#include<bits/stdc++.h>
#define f first
#define s second
#define ll long long
#define pii pair<ll,ll>
using namespace std;
const int N = 3e5 + 5;
int a[N], val[N],  cur = 0;
ll dp[3][2][N];
pii tree[4 * N];
void upd(int u, int id, int l, int r, int t) {
	if(l > id || r < id) return;
	if(l == r) {
		tree[u].f += t;
		
		tree[u].s += val[l] * t;
		return;
	}
	int mid = (l + r) / 2;
	upd(2 * u, id, l, mid, t);
	upd(2 * u + 1, id, mid + 1, r, t);
	tree[u].f = tree[2 * u].f + tree[2 * u + 1].f;
	tree[u].s = tree[2 * u].s + tree[2 * u + 1].s;
}
ll get(int u, int l, int r, int k) {
	if(!k) return 0;
	if(l == r) {
		return (ll) min(tree[u].f, (ll)k) * val[l];
	}
	int mid = (l + r) / 2;
	if(tree[2 * u + 1].f > k) {
		return get(2 * u + 1, mid + 1, r, k);
	}
	return tree[2 * u + 1].s + get(2 * u, l, mid, k - tree[2 * u + 1].f);
}
ll get(int x) {
	if(x < 0) return -1e5;
	return get(1, 1, cur, x);
}

void solve(int optl, int optr, int l, int r,int price, int t) {
	if(l > r || optl > optr) return;
	int mid = (l + r) / 2; //cout << l << "__" << r << endl;
	ll opt = 0, optm = optl;
	for(int i = optl; i <= optr; i++) {
		upd(1, a[i], 1, cur, 1);
		if(opt <= get(mid - (ll)i * price)) {
			opt = get(mid - (ll)i * price);
			optm = i;
		}
	}
	dp[price][t][mid] = opt; 
	for(int i = optm; i <= optr; i++) upd(1, a[i], 1, cur, -1); 
	if(l != r) solve(optm, optr, mid + 1, r, price, t);
	for(int i = optl; i < optm; i++) upd(1, a[i], 1, cur, -1);
	if(l != r) solve(optl, optm, l, mid - 1, price, t);
	
}
long long findMaxAttraction(int n, int start, int d, int attraction[]) {
	vector<int> x;
	ll sum  = 0;
	for(int i = 0; i < n; i++) x.push_back(attraction[i]), sum += attraction[i];
	sort(x.begin(), x.end());
	cur =0 ;
	map<int,int> id;
	for(int i = 0; i < x.size(); i++) {
		if(!i || x[i] != x[i - 1]) ++cur;
		id[x[i]] = cur;
		val[cur] = x[i];
	}
	for(int i = 0; i < n; i++) attraction[i] = id[attraction[i]];
	for(int i = 0; i < n - start; i++) a[i] = attraction[i + start];
    solve(0, n - start - 1, 1, d, 1, 0);
    solve(0, n - start - 1, 1, d, 2, 0);
    for(int i = start - 1; i >= 0; i--) a[start - 1 - i] = attraction[i];
	solve(0, start - 1, 1, d, 1, 1);
	solve(0, start - 1, 1, d, 2, 1);
	for(int i = d; i >= 1; i--) {
		dp[1][1][i] = dp[1][1][i - 1];
		if(i == 1) dp[2][1][i] = 0;
		else dp[2][1][i] = dp[2][1][i - 2];
	}
    ll ans = 0;
    for(int i = 0; i <= d; i++) {
    
    	ans = max(ans, dp[1][0][i] + dp[2][1][d - i]);
    	ans = max(ans, dp[2][0][i] + dp[1][1][d - i]);
   
	}
    return ans;
}
